Output 5956282df3431c50ea3fcfb389ae7bf29b0481b8c8064f6b473924403bb78130:1

value
358437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 623f1710cf61db6108cd8106487335b20fdb3904 OP_EQUAL
address
3AeVivKduGXu9VxfVa5H5DtuPGHmVsejUA
transaction
5956282df3431c50ea3fcfb389ae7bf29b0481b8c8064f6b473924403bb78130
confirmations
250756
spent
true